Source: The Collaborative International Dictionary of English v.0.48
Carillon
	Carillon \Car"il*lon\, n. [F. carillon a chime of bells,
   originally consisting of four bells, as if fr.. (assumed) L.
   quadrilio, fr. quatuer four.]
   [1913 Webster]
   1. (Mus.) A chime of bells diatonically tuned, played by
      clockwork or by finger keys.
      [1913 Webster]

   2. A tune adapted to be played by musical bells.
      [1913 Webster]

Source: WordNet (r) 2.0
Carillon
	carillon
     n 1: set of bells hung in a bell tower
     2: playing a set of bells that are (usually) hung in a tower
        [syn: bell ringing, carillon playing]
     [also: carillonning, carillonned]
